2. The Importance of Secure Wallets
When buying cryptocurrencies, it is crucial to have a secure wallet to store your digital assets. A wallet is a software program that allows you to send, receive, and store cryptocurrencies. There are various types of wallets, including hardware wallets, software wallets, and mobile wallets. It is essential to choose a wallet that offers strong security features to protect your investments.

4. Choosing the Right Cryptocurrency Exchange
To buy cryptocurrencies, you need to select the right exchange. Here are some factors to consider when choosing an exchange:
- Reputation: Look for an exchange with a strong reputation and a history of reliable operations.
- Security: Ensure the exchange has robust security measures, such as two-factor authentication and cold storage for assets.
- Fees: Compare the fees charged by different exchanges to find the most cost-effective option.
- Liquidity: Choose an exchange with high liquidity to ensure you can buy and sell cryptocurrencies without affecting the market price.
- User Experience: Consider the ease of use and user interface of the exchange.

6. How to Buy Cryptocurrencies Using Software
To buy cryptocurrencies using software, follow these steps:
1. Create an account on a reputable cryptocurrency exchange or platform.
2. Verify your identity by providing the necessary documents.
3. Deposit funds into your account using a payment method, such as a credit card, bank transfer, or cryptocurrency.
4. Navigate to the trading section of the platform and select the cryptocurrency you want to buy.
5. Enter the amount of cryptocurrency you wish to purchase and place your order.
6. Wait for the transaction to be processed and the cryptocurrency to be credited to your wallet.

9. Risks and Considerations When Buying Cryptocurrencies
Buying cryptocurrencies comes with certain risks and considerations:
- Market volatility: Cryptocurrency markets can be highly volatile, leading to significant price fluctuations.
- Security risks: Your digital assets are vulnerable to hacking and theft.
- Regulatory uncertainty: Cryptocurrency regulations vary by country, and the legal status of cryptocurrencies may change.
- Lack of consumer protection: Unlike traditional financial institutions, cryptocurrency exchanges and platforms may not offer the same level of consumer protection.

4. What is the difference between a hot wallet and a cold wallet?
A hot wallet is an online wallet that allows you to access your cryptocurrencies from anywhere, while a cold wallet is a physical device that stores your cryptocurrencies offline, providing enhanced security.
